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Group, Inc., originally founded in 1924 as Sumitomo Trust Co., Ltd., and headquartered in Tokyo, Japan, is a major Japanese financial holding company that evolved through the 2011 merger of Chuo Mitsui Trust Holdings and Sumitomo Trust and Banking Co., Ltd., forming its core entity,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Bank. Renamed from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Holdings in October 2024, it is Japan’s largest trust bank and fifth-largest bank by assets, managing hundreds of billions through services like trust banking, asset management, real estate, and financial brokerage for retail and institutional clients. Distinct from the Sumitomo Mitsui Financial Group despite shared historical roots in the Sumitomo and Mitsui conglomerates, the group emphasizes sustainability and long-term client solutions, operating globally with subsidiaries in cities like New York, London, and Hong Kong. Under leaders like Chairman Kazuo Ohmori, it blends a century-long legacy with modern financial innovation, focusing on pension funds, real estate trusts, and ESG-driven investments.

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Group's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2022,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Group held 1,260 positions worth $122B, down 6.4% from $130B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 21% of the portfolio.

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Group's Q3 2022 filing shows 46 new, 401 increased, 664 reduced and 61 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Tenet Healthcare: 661,998 shares worth $34.1M. The largest sale was Apple, an estimated $148M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 25% of assets, down from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
